In the issue Raymond Hettinger proposed adding method to string, that would allow to explicitly pass subscriptable object, from which formatting of a string would be done. Two questions arise: 1) whether add such functionality at all? 2) how the method should be called? Should formatting options based on *args be kept (like using {0} in formatted string) or not and how argument should be passed. Eric suggested passing only mapping and only adding *args, if that is found useful by users; I have though about having both mapping and *args, which would keep it similar to the old formatting. Another option is to have *args and one keyword with the mapping (instead of kwargs).
